What is NAD+ and How Does it Work?
Imagine NAD+ as a rechargeable battery pack our cells use to power repairs and daily tasks. Every breath and bite we take gets turned into fuel, but our cells need this battery to shuttle energy where it is needed. With age, our battery pack drains faster and takes longer to refill. Inflammation and life stress act like rust that slows our engines. Our internal repair crews, called sirtuins, rely on this battery to tune our engines and clean out damaged parts. Without enough charge, energy dips and small glitches pile up into bigger roadblocks.
Our bodies use this molecule to power two vital teams. One team patches tiny tears in our instruction manual, also known as DNA. Another team tunes our engines so they burn fuel cleanly instead of puffing smoke, also known as free radicals. When our battery runs low, repairs slow down and smoke builds up, making our system feel sluggish. Studies suggest that keeping this battery topped off helps both teams work in harmony so we can adapt to life’s demands with fewer sputters and stalls.

Why It Matters for Your Healthspan
Healthspan is the number of years we feel strong and engaged. If lifespan is the total time on the clock, healthspan is the time we spend living fully. When our engines sputter, daily tasks feel heavier, and recovery takes longer. Research indicates that steadier energy stores help us bounce back from stress, stay active, and keep our minds sharp. This is why mitochondrial vitality is a big deal for everyday life.
